Program Analysis

Graduates earn $30,228/yr, edging above the $26,180 national average for Business Operations Support — a modest premium that suggests solid regional demand for this trade.

Every dollar of tuition returns an estimated 139.4x in decade earnings — an exceptional ratio that places this among the highest-ROI Business Operations Support programs nationally.

Some AI exposure exists in Business Operations Support's career paths, with 67% of job tasks potentially affected. The pessimistic scenario still projects solid returns, with a 9% gap from the optimistic case.

Median debt of $19,090 represents roughly 8 months of the $30,228 starting salary — a manageable burden by trade school standards.

At #4 of 155 nationally, this is a top-5% Business Operations Support program. Financial outcomes consistently outperform the vast majority of peers.

Business Operations Support offers 17 registered apprenticeship pathways — an unusually broad set of earn-while-you-learn alternatives to the classroom track.
